Pre-Requisites
Before initiating this service, ensure the following:
1. The company must have already updated its registered address with the Revenue Department (RD) and Department of Business Development (DBD) if applicable.
2. Ensure that all required documentation is prepared and verified for submission.
Documentation Needed
To complete the address change with the SSO, the following documents are required:
1. Company Affidavit – Issued within the last six months.
2. Previous and Updated Rental Agreement – Including lease contracts or ownership documents for the new address.
3. Copy of the Director’s ID Card/Passport – Must have at least six months’ validity.
4. Power of Attorney – If a representative is filing on behalf of the company, this document must be notarized.
5. Updated Employee List – If applicable, detailing current employees registered with the SSO.
6. Map of the New Address – Clearly labeled and detailed.
Note: All documents must be certified as true copies and translated into Thai (if necessary).

Timeline:
The process generally takes 3–7 business days, depending on the completeness of documentation and SSO processing times.

Government Fees and Taxes
• Government Fee: No government fee is applicable for this process.
